Transaction 72ab75c03d379abf346658c080313b797af754e33255a25cade3f3d5d7a1cd07
1 Input
1 Output
-
72ab75c03d379abf346658c080313b797af754e33255a25cade3f3d5d7a1cd07:0
- value
- 18391165
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cadeb226cf73a9b96948270d3d5b204f2b81bc4
- address
- bc1q8jk7kgnv7uafh955sfcd84djqnetsx7ypzmdvz